• 제목/요약/키워드: UDDI(Universal Description Discovery and Integration)

검색결과 13건 처리시간 0.024초

XML 웹 서비스 검색 엔진의 개발 (Development of a XML Web Services Retrieval Engine)

  • 손승범;오일진;황윤영;이경하;이규철
    • Journal of Information Technology Applications and Management
    • /
    • 제13권4호
    • /
    • pp.121-140
    • /
    • 2006
  • UDDI (Universal Discovery Description and Integration) Registry is used for Web Services registration and search. UDDI offers the search result to the keyword-based query. UDDI supports WSDL registration but it does not supports WSDL search. So it is required that contents based search and ranking using name and description in UDDI registration information and WSDL. This paper proposes a retrieval engine considering contents of services registered in the UDDI and WSDL. It uses Vector Space Model for similarity comparison between contents of those. UDDI registry information hierarchy and WSDL hierarchy are considered during searching process. This engine suppports two discovery methods. One is Keyword-based search and the other is template-based search supporting ranking for user's query. Template-based search offers how service interfaces correspond to the query for WSDL documents. Proposed retrieval engine can offer search result more accurately than one which UDDI offers and it can retrieve WSDL which is registered in UDDI in detail.

  • PDF

웹 서비스 등록 절차의 개선 방안 (Improved Web Service Publishing Method)

  • 최유순;신현철;박종구
    • 한국정보통신학회논문지
    • /
    • 제9권1호
    • /
    • pp.1-7
    • /
    • 2005
  • 현재의 웹 서비스 구조는 제공자가 UDDI에 서비스에 대한 정보를 등록하는 일로 시작한다. 사용자가 UDDI에서 서비스 목록을 검색하면 서비스의 위치를 전송받아 제공자에게 WSDL을 요청한다. 제공자는 WSDL을 전달하면, 사용자는 WSDL에 정의되어 있는 프로시저와 파라미터 데이터 타입에 맞추어 서비스를 요청한다. 본 논문에서는 이러한 웹 서비스 절차를 개선하였다. WSDL을 저장하기 위한 WSDL베이스를 이용하였다. WSDL 베이스는 WSDL 매니저에 의하여 관리된다. 서비스 제공자가 서비스를 등록할 때 서비스에 대한 정보를 UDDI 레지스트리에 저장하며, 이 때 WSDL을 같이 전송하도록 하였다.

UDDI 레지스트리와 웹 기반의 컴포넌트 저장소의 통합에 관한 연구 (A Study on Integrating UDDI Registry and Web-Based Component Repository)

  • 이동근;최은만
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2004년도 가을 학술발표논문집 Vol.31 No.2 (2)
    • /
    • pp.520-522
    • /
    • 2004
  • UDDI(Universal Description, Discovery, and Integration) 레지스트리(Registry)는 클라이언트가 각종 정보들을 생성, 저장, 검색할 수 있는 XML 기반의 자료저장 장치이다. XML 기반의 저장 장치이므로 개발언어 및 실행 플랫폼과는 상관없이 데이터 교환이 자유롭다. UDDI는 특정한 웹 서비스 시스템에 대한 정보를 체계적으로 분류하여 제공한다. 하지만, UDDI에서는 아직 컴포넌트에 대한 정보를 제공하는 부분에는 부족한 점이 있다. 컴포넌트의 재사용성이 증가됨에 따라 웹 기반의 컴포넌트 저장소를 구축하여 재사용 컴포넌트를 제공하는 사이트들이 늘어가는 추세이다. 이에 따라 UDDI 레지스트리와 웹 기반의 컴포넌트 저장소를 연계함으로써 불필요한 컴포넌트들에 대한 정보를 줄이고, 분산된 컴포넌트 저장소에서 컴포넌트에 대한 정보를 데이터 북 형태로 정보를 제공하여 웹서비스를 이용하여 빠른 기간에 응용 시스템을 개발할 수 있다. 본 논문에서는 UDDI 레지스트리의 특징을 살려 웹 기반의 컴포넌트 저장소에서 제공하는 데이터 북 형태의 컴포넌트 정보 제공 서비스를 연계함으로써 UDDI 레지스트리와 웹 기반의 컴포넌트 저장소의 단점들을 보완하는 해결책을 제시하고 실험하였다.

  • PDF

USN응용 서비스를 위한 이벤트 및 서비스 레지스트리 시스템 (Event and Service registry system for USN Application Services)

  • 염성근;김용운;유상근;김형준;정회경
    • 한국정보통신학회논문지
    • /
    • 제13권7호
    • /
    • pp.1459-1466
    • /
    • 2009
  • 유비쿼터스(Ubiquitous) 환경에서는 다양한 공간에 RFID, 센서 네트워크 등으로부터 지속적이고, 주기적으로 사용자 및 사물에 관한 다양하고 방대한 양의 센서 데이터 정보가 발생한다. 이러한 센서 서비스를 제공하는 수많은 제공자들 중에서 사용자는 자신이 원하는 서비스를 찾을 수 있어야 하며, 해당 서비스를 사용 시, 사용자의 요구에 맞는 서비스를 제공받아야 한다. 그러나 현재의 USN(Ubiquitous Sensor Network) 응용 서비스 환경에서는 이런 일련의 서비스들을 검색할 수 있는 레지스트리가 거의 없으며, 있더라도 비즈니스 위주의 UDDI(Universal desccription discovery, and integration)만이 존재한다. 또한, 서비스를 사용시 사용자의 요구에 맞는 서비스를 제공해야 하지만, 현재의 서비스들은 하나의 조건 또는 이벤트에 따른 서비스만 제공한다. 따라서 여러 조건이나 이벤트에 따라 서비스를 제공할 수 있는 룰 기반의 서비스 이벤트 처리 시스템이 필요하다. 이에 본 논문에서는 기존 UDDI를 참고한 센서 서비스 검색을 위한 서비스 레지스트리 시스템 및 WS-ECA(Web Service Event Conditon Action)와 같은 웹서비스(Web Service) 기반의 이벤트 룰을 참고한 USN 응용 서비스를 위한 이벤트처리 시스템에 대한 연구를 하였다.

웹 서비스 품질 모니터링을 제공하는 UDDI 중개자 시스템 (UDDI Broker System Supporting Web Services QoS Monitoring)

  • 염귀덕;민덕기
    • 한국컴퓨터정보학회논문지
    • /
    • 제10권4호
    • /
    • pp.337-344
    • /
    • 2005
  • UDDI 서버는 웹 서비스를 등록하고 검색하는데 사용되는 레지스트리다. 그러나 일반적으로 UDDI 서버는 웹 서비스의 품질에 관한 정보를 제공해주지 않기 때문에 웹 서비스 사용자가 품질 좋은 웹 서비스를 선택하기 위해서는 웹 서비스의 품질에 대한 정보를 제공해주는 중개자와 웹 서비스의 품질을 모니터링하기 위한 측정 요소가 필요하다. 본 논문에서는 웹 서비스의 품질을 모니터링하고 모니터링 결과를 웹기반으로 제공해주는 UDDI 중개자 시스템을 설계하고 구현하였다. 이 UDDI 중개자 시스템은 웹 서비스의 품질 정보를 수치와 그래프로 보여줌으로써 사용자가 품질 좋은 웹 서비스를 선택할 수 있게 해준다. 우리 연구에서는 사용가능성, 성능, 그리고 안정성 측면의 품질을 모니터 링의 측정 요소로 삼았다.

  • PDF

웹 서비스 사용자의 블랙 박스 테스트를 위한 요구명세에 관한 연구 (A Study on Requirement Specification for Black-Box Testing of Web Services User)

  • 이동근;최은만
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2005년도 춘계학술발표대회
    • /
    • pp.397-400
    • /
    • 2005
  • 웹 서비스는 사용자의 요청에 따라 솔루션을 제공하기 위해 임의로 찾아 결합될 수 있는 컴포넌트이다. 다시 말해 웹 서비스는 CBD(Component-Based Development)와 웹 형태의 결합이라 볼 수 있다. 웹 서비스는 UDDI(Universal Description, Discovery, and Integration), WSDL(Web Service Description Language), SOAP(Simple Object Access Protocol)과 같은 표준화된 기술들로 이루어졌다. 이미 개발된 컴포넌트를 재사용하기 위해서는 해당 컴포넌트에 대한 정확한 정보를 토대로 테스트를 하여 조합하게 된다. 하지만, 현재 웹 서비스 기술이나 표준에서는 테스트를 위한 방법이나 데이터를 제공하고 있지 않다. 물론 WSDL 에서는 데이터의 입. 출력 값에 대한 타입은 제공하고 있지만, 이것으로는 정확한 테스트는 물론 불필요한 테스트 케이스를 증가 시킨다. 따라서 본 논문에서는 현재 웹 서비스의 명세인 WSDL 에 대해 블랙 박스 테스트를 위해 필요한 데이터 측면에 대한 문제점을 알아보고, 이를 보완할 수 있는 요구명세서를 제안함과 동시에 요구명세서의 제공 방안을 제시하였다.

  • PDF

USN을 이용한 효율적인 USR 시스템 설계 및 구현 (An Efficient USR system design and implementation based on the USN)

  • 진우정;초황;정대령;신극재;정회경
    • 한국정보통신학회:학술대회논문집
    • /
    • 한국해양정보통신학회 2010년도 춘계학술대회
    • /
    • pp.451-453
    • /
    • 2010
  • 세계는 지금 미래 지능기반 사회로 급속히 진화되고 있다. 이와 같은 상황에서 USN(Ubiquitous Sensor Network)은 미래 유비쿼터스(Ubiquitous) 사회를 구현하는 핵심 인프라로서 대두되고 있다. 유비쿼터스 컴퓨팅(Ubiquitous Computing)을 실현하기 위해서는 USN에 포함되어 있는 수많은 센서들로부터 감지된 데이터를 실시간 수집하고 처리하여 서비스를 이용하는 이용자에게 가공되어 전달되어야 한다. USN 센서 데이터는 이용 시 수많은 센서 데이터 제공 서비스를 이용하기 위해 서비스 제공자들이 표준화된 레지스트리에 자신의 서비스를 등록하고, 이용자는 서비스 레지스트리를 검색하여 이용 할 수 있어야 한다. 그러나 기존연구에서 웹 서비스 표준으로 사용한 WS-Eventing 과 UDDI(Universal Description, Discovery, and Integration)는 USN 응용 서비스를 위한 USR(USN Service Registry)으로서 불필요하거나 부족한 점이 있다. 이에 본 논문에서는 센서들의 데이터를 제공하는 서비스 제공자가 자신의 서비스 정보를 등록하고, 서비스 이용자가 필요한 이용 정보를 탐색 및 조회하기 위한 레지스트리의 시스템에 관해 설계 및 구현하였다.

  • PDF

다중 속성 의사결정에 의한 웹 서비스 선정 프로세스에 관한 연구 (A Study on Selection Process of Web Services Based on the Multi-Attributes Decision Making)

  • 서영준;송영재
    • 정보처리학회논문지D
    • /
    • 제13D권4호
    • /
    • pp.603-612
    • /
    • 2006
  • 최근 웹 서비스 분야는 SOA(Services-Oriented Architecture)에 대한 관심의 증가와 B2B 시장의 성장으로 인해 차세대 IT 패러다임으로 급부상하고 있다. UDDI(Universal Description, Discovery and Integration)를 통한 서비스 발견은 오직 기능적 측면에만 기반을 두기 때문에, 서비스의 사용 빈도와 상호간의 신뢰성에 미치는 영향은 고려하지 않았다. 즉, 웹 서비스의 비기능적 측면인 품질은 소비자와 제공자 상호간에 성공을 위한 중요한 요인이 될 것이며, 이에 품질을 고려한 웹 서비스 선정 방법이 요구된다. 본 논문에서는 서비스 소비자의 입장에서 소비자가 원하는 최적의 품질을 제공하는 서비스를 찾도록 도와주는 에이전트 기반 품질 브로커 아키텍처와 선정 프로세스를 제안한다. 웹 서비스와 같이 분산되고 이질적인 환경에서 에이전트에 관한 이론들은 널리 받아들여지고 있으므로 제안하는 시스템 아키텍처에 적합하다. 본 논문에서는 웹 서비스 선정에 관한 기존 연구의 문제점을 개선하기 위해 평가과정에서 QoS와 CoS를 고려하였으며, 평가 방법으로 다기준 의사결정 기법들 중에서 웹 서비스 선정에 가장 적합하다고 판단된 PROMETHEE(Preference Ranking Organization MeTHod for Enrichment Evaluations)를 사용하였다. PROMETHEE는 비교 서비스들이 추가되거나 삭제되더라도 이원비교를 다시 수행해야 하는 문제를 극복할 수 있는 장점이 있다. 본 논문에서는 제시한 선정 프로세스를 검증하기 위하여 서비스 조합 시나리오를 갖는 사례 연구를 제시하였다. 사례 연구에서 웹 서비스 선정 프로세스는 소비자 관점의 품질 측정값과 정의된 서비스 레벨을 바탕으로 의사 결정 문제를 기술하였다.

전력 설비 감시 시스템들 간의 정보 교환 기법에 관한 연구 (A Study on the Information Exchange Technique among Electric Power Facilities and Monitoring Systems)

  • 홍창호;박찬엄;이승철;문운철
    • 한국조명전기설비학회:학술대회논문집
    • /
    • 한국조명전기설비학회 2006년도 춘계학술대회 논문집
    • /
    • pp.453-456
    • /
    • 2006
  • In this paper, we introduce the design and implementation of Information exchange technique among power system facilities and/or their monitoring systems based on Universal Description, Discovery and Integration Service and Simple Object Access Protocol. The rapid progresses in high speed network, 4G web language S/W and embedded H/W enabled faster and easier communications among electric power systems monitoring facilities. However, each facility or system has its own specific protocol like RS-232 and RS-486, which somewhat limits the capability of flexible information exchange among thor In this paper, we try to demonstrate the potential of utilizing the SOAP and UDDI services in exchanging the metadata and possibly high abstraction level informations among electric power facilities and/or their monitoring systems.

  • PDF

A Study on Quality Broker to Users Web Service Selection Based on Non-Functional Attributes

  • Sim, Sung-Ho;Song, Young-Jae
    • International Journal of Contents
    • /
    • 제5권3호
    • /
    • pp.8-13
    • /
    • 2009
  • The recent Web service field emerges as the fastest growing IT paradigm as a result of the increasing interest in SOA (Services-Oriented Architecture) and the expansion of B2B market. With an increasing number of Web service that provide similar features, it becomes more important to provide the most appropriate service for the user's request. A service user in general requires the quality information of Web service when selecting a service among a number of similar Web services. Yet, finding a service through UDDI (Universal Description, Discovery and Integration) does not consider the non-functional aspects of users because it is only based on the functional aspects. That is, the quality, non-functional aspect will be an important factor for the mutual success of the user and provider. Using 3 factors in the Qos factors of the existing studies: the execution cost, reliability, and the quality level, the QoS of Web service is saved and the factors for the QoS are recorded in order to consider non-functional factors when selecting a Web service in this study. The Quality Broker determines the rank and shows the desired result of the service for users. The Quality Broker suggested in this thesis can be used to select a Web Service that considers the user-oriented and non-functional factors.